If, hypothetically, you had to do this, you'd just lift the futures.
Make sure the pit knows you are there and you have deep pockets, then pick your level, and persistently lift them on the screen. Tick by tick.
Index arb and delta-1 desks at the large banks then have to lift the stocks to keep up with the index. You don't care which stocks, that's their problem. And the genius thing is it's rare for large banks to ever hit the 3% threshold, as they repo out the stock to hedge funds who want to short.
Voila, problem gone. Market higher. Only people who lose are the ones who sold you the futures.
